It’s first of October! October for most people is the time to enjoy the autumn leaves, and have fun with kids on Halloween, for ski enthusiasts it is the time to start already thinking the upcoming ski season. Here are the top six tips what to do in October to get ready for the upcoming ski season. 1. Book Your Ski Trip To get the best deals to travel this upcoming ski season, book your trip in October. Flights are cheaper when you book them now and many resorts offer travels deals, and you can save a good chunk by booking already now. Depending the location, many ski resorts try to open the slopes already around Thanksgiving, but since there is no guarantee of the weather, make sure to contact your favorite ski resort to ask when they are planning on opening, before you book your early-season ski trip. 2. Save Money on Gear – Shop Now for Last Season If you are fast, now is the time to get the best deals on ski gear – if you are willing to buy last years models. You can save up to 75% of the retail price on last year’s ski gear, as the stores are getting ready to stock their shelves with new winter 2010 ski gear. Better yet… some stores offer pre-season sales, like for example Sun and Ski Sports – they already have some winter 2010 skis in and you can save up to 200 dollars on some of the newest skis. 3. Save Even More Money on Gear – Swap or Rent If for some reason you can not find a deal on new skis right now, or still would like to save a little more money – look for local ski swaps, check out used skis at eBay, Craig’s List or see if a ski rental shop is selling any of their used inventory. Your local ski shops will know about the ski swaps – just call and ask! If you are looking for ski gear for kids – look for garage sales, post an ad for Craig’s List to buy used gear or rent it. Most ski shops have season rentals, and you don’t have to worry about returning the skis until the end of the season next spring. If you plan on skiing with the kids only a few times a season, I would also consider renting directly from the resorts you are visiting.

Get Your Season Ski Pass on Discounted Price Many resorts are offering reduced priced season passes still a few more weeks. The cut date for discounted season passes for several ski resorts is October 15th, from Park City Mountain Resort in Utah to Killington Resort in Vermont.
